In the fast-paced world of fx trading, robotisation has revolutionized the particular way traders operate, allowing for more quickly execution and more sophisticated strategies. MetaTrader 4 (MT4) continues to be one of the most widely used platforms, primarily because of its capability to support custom Professional Advisors (EAs), indications, and scripts. These types of programs are generally compiled into ex4 files, which happen to be encrypted to shield mental property and be sure safety measures. However, this security also provides an impressive obstacle for traders in addition to developers who would like to realize how certain automated strategies work. This is how ex4 decompilers get play—a powerful tool that can reverse-engineer compiled ex4 files back to readable origin code, unlocking the particular secrets behind prosperous trading algorithms.
A great ex4 decompiler is a specialized software designed to analyze the binary framework of compiled ex4 files and transfer them back directly into high-level code, like as MQL4 or MQL5. As the unique source code will be encrypted, decompilers evaluate the machine program code to reconstruct a version of the signal which is intelligible intended for humans. This procedure involves complex reverse-engineering techniques, interpreting the particular compiled binary, plus reassembling logical set ups, variables, and functions. For traders and developers, this capacity provides an invaluable window into just how certain EAs or indicators operate—helping them learn, modify, or even improve existing techniques.
The process regarding decompilation, however, is definitely not always straightforward. It involves studying the compiled binary data, identifying designs, and translating coaching sets into high-level programming language. Whilst modern decompilers are usually quite advanced in addition to can accurately restore much of the original logic, that they are not flawless—especially when the ex4 files are actually heavily obfuscated or encrypted to be able to prevent decompilation. Nevertheless, many decompilers can produce a shut approximation of the source code, providing users insights straight into the underlying reasoning, trading signals, plus risk management approaches embedded within a good EA.
It’s important to address the legal and honourable dimensions surrounding ex4 decompilation. Many builders encrypt their files to protect their particular intellectual property, and even decompiling these data files without permission may infringe upon copyrights or licensing deals. Responsible use of decompilers involves only analyzing files a person own or have got explicit permission in order to examine. Unauthorized decompilation of proprietary Expert advisors as they are commonly referred to may lead in order to legal consequences in addition to ethical concerns. Consequently, traders and designers must exercise extreme care, ensuring they keep to legal requirements and respect intelligent property rights.
In spite of these challenges, decompilers are invaluable resources for legitimate functions such as recuperating lost source computer code, learning how successful systems are created, or improving one’s own trading methods. Developers often decompile their very own EAs to understand that they operate or to enhance their performance. Traders can analyze decompiled code to gain insights into transmission generation, risk administration, and strategy design and style. When used reliably, decompilers foster development, learning, and visibility within the stock trading community, helping persons develop better, extra informed strategies.
The technology behind ex4 decompilers continues in order to evolve rapidly. Contemporary tools offer higher accuracy, better dealing with of encryption methods, and even more user-friendly barrière. Since the capabilities involving decompilers grow, consequently will the importance regarding understanding the moral implications of their very own use. Staying educated about legal limits and practicing liable decompilation—focused on personalized learning or approved analysis—is essential to avoid potential legitimate issues.
ex4 Decompiler In bottom line, an ex4 decompiler is a powerful device that could unlock the mysteries encoded inside MetaTrader’s compiled data files. Whether you’re the trader aiming to recognize successful strategies or perhaps a developer recuperating lost code, decompilers provide an useful resource—if used ethically and responsibly. As automated trading continues to advance, perfecting the art of decompilation can provide you a competitive edge in the particular forex market. Remember: with great power comes great responsibility—always respect intellectual home rights and legal frameworks.